大佬们,今天要聊的技术活就是那句“手机怎么访问腾讯云服务器”。别以为手机只能玩游戏、刷微博,拿它当远程操作终端也绝不错!先统统把你那台电脑先关上,测试下一波手机与云服务器的“空气互通”吧!
先说手把手:第一步,打开手机的终端模拟器,常用的有Termux、JuiceSSH、并且它们可以在App Store或者Google Play免费入手。安装好后,打开极简界面,准备输入第一行指令——ssh:
ssh root@你的云服务器公网IP
这就像是给你的服务器打电话啦,先确保服务器已经开通了SSH(默认22端口)。如果你不想使用root,记得在腾讯云控制台里提前创建一个普通用户,再把公钥加入对应的密钥对。
第二步,你得准备一个“钥匙”,绝大多数大佬都喜欢用SSH密钥代替密码。生成公钥私钥对可以在Termux里执行:
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
这样,就会在~/.ssh目录生成id_rsa和id_rsa.pub。将id_rsa.pub里的内容复制到腾讯云服务器的“安全设置—>密钥对”里,或直接在服务器的~/.ssh/authorized_keys文件中粘贴。别忘了设置文件权限为 600( chmod 600 ~/.ssh/authorized_keys )。
第三步,打开安全组设置,确认弹窗是否允许22端口的入站。千万别让安全组给你“断线”,先点 安全组 - 包规则 - 添加规则,选择协议为TCP,端口范围22,来源IP可以设为10.0.0.1/0 或直接 0.0.0.0/0 方便测试。要是你想进一步细化,只要把自己的公网IP写进去即可。
第四步,别只在服务端搞事,若要把手机名字给服务器记在文件里,搞个 /etc/hostname 写上名称,或者直接打命令:
hostnamectl set-hostname mobile-ssh-伙伴
这样重启后,你的连接就会显示“mobile-ssh-伙伴”,看着像成长故事一样。
第六步开始实验:
1. 重新打开Termux
2. 输入 ssh -p 22 -i ~/.ssh/id_rsa -o StrictHostKeyChecking=no root@IP
3. 如果你爱玩黑匣子,记得加 -vvv 看一眼连接的细节,微调网络不一样顺感控。华丽叹息,一旦把云服务器的命令行打开,手机就成了一台小型终端,玩转高能脚本。lulwh 嘞...好啦,接下来你想搞大一点吗?
说到标题里的小金句,觉得很另类吗?没事!让我们把手机变成闪闪的“云口”,一边玩游戏一边给服务器送上Git push,或者无底洞式的手动监测脚本。形、色、直观只要你复制粘贴就行。你可以给今天的镜像安装进置顶脚本一键备份,即使遭到内存瓶颈攻击也能 及时顺备份,骄傲爆表。
说实话,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ink 只是一句小广告,却足够让你手里紧握亿万家伙的先赚机会。你们看,连手机也能把云服务器听写、指令、维护都没惊吓到。咱接下来如果你还有疑问,直接抛来吧,接着继续聊。嘿!出现的那位说明没来得及停下来,怎么了?